●When an Apple CarPlay/Android 
Auto connection is established, 
the function of some system but-
tons will change.
●When an Apple CarPlay/Android 
Auto connection is established, 
some system functions, such as 
the following, will  be replaced by 
similar Apple CarPlay/Android 
Auto functions or will become 
unavailable:
• iPod (Audio Playback)
• USB audio/USB video
• Bluetooth
® audio
• Bluetooth® phone (Apple CarPlay 
only)
• Toyota apps
●When an Apple CarPlay/Android 
Auto connection is established, 
voice command system (Siri/Goo-
gle Assistant) and map application 
voice guidance volume can be 
changed by selecting “Voice Vol-
ume” on the voice settings screen. 
(  P.66) It cannot be changed by 
“POWER VOLUME” knob on 
Audio control panel.
●Apple CarPlay/Android Auto is an 
application developed by Apple 
Inc/Google LLC. Its functions and 
services may be terminated or 
changed without notice depending 
on the connected device’s opera-
tion system, hardware and soft-
ware, or due to changes in Apple 
CarPlay/Android Auto specifica-
tions.
●For a list of the apps supported by 
Apple CarPlay or Android Auto, 
refer to their respective website.
●While using these functions, vehi-
cle and user information, such as 
location and vehicle speed, will be 
shared with the  respective appli-
cation publisher and the cellular 
service provider.
●By downloading and using each 
application, you agree to their 
terms of use.
●Data for these functions is trans- mitted using the in
ternet and may 
incur charges.
For information about data trans-
mission fees, contact your cellular 
service provider.
●Depending on the application, cer-
tain functions, such as music play-
back, may be restricted.
●As the applications  for each func-
tion are provided by a third-party, 
they may be subject to change or 
discontinuation without notice.
For details, refer  to the website of 
the function.
●If the vehicle’s navigation system 
is being used for route guidance 
and a route is set using the Apple 
CarPlay/Android Auto Maps app, 
route guidance will be performed 
through Apple CarPlay/Android 
Auto.
If the Apple CarPlay/Android Auto 
Maps app is being used for route 
guidance and a rou te is set using 
the vehicle’s navigation system, 
route guidance will be performed 
by the vehicle’s navigation sys-
tem.
●If the USB cable is disconnected, 
operation of Apple CarPlay/
Android Auto will end.
At this time, sound output will stop 
and change to the system screen.
●Use of the Apple CarPlay logo 
means that a vehicle user inter-
face meets Apple  performance 
standards. Apple is not responsi-
ble for the operation of this vehicle 
or its compliance with safety and 
regulatory standards. Please note 
that the use of this product with 
iPhone or iPod may affect wire-
less performance.

If you are experiencing difficulti es with Apple CarPlay/Android Auto, 
check the following table.
Troubleshooting
SymptomSolution
An Apple Car-
Play/Android Auto con-
nection cannot be 
established.
Check if the device supports Apple CarPlay/
Android Auto.
Check if Apple CarPl ay/Android Auto is 
enabled on the connected device.
Check if that the Androi d Auto application is 
installed to the device to be connected.
For details, refer to 
Apple CarPlay: https: //www.apple.com/ios/
carplay/.
Android Auto: https://w ww.android.com/auto/
.
For available countries or areas for Apple Car-
Play, refer to https://w ww.apple.com/ios/
feature-availability/#apple-carplay.
Check if “Apple CarPla y”/“Android Auto” of 
“Projection Settings” on the general settings 
screen is set to on. ( P. 6 2 )
Check if the USB cable be ing used is securely 
connected to the device and USB port.
Check that the device is  connected directly to 
the USB port of the system and not connected 
to a USB hub.
For Apple CarPlay: Check if the Lightning cable 
being used is certified by Apple. Check if Siri is 
enabled.
After checking all of the above, try to establish 
an Apple CarPlay/Android Auto connection. 
(  P.55, 56)
When an Apple CarPlay/
Android Auto connection 
is established and a video 
is being played, the video 
is not displayed, but audio 
is output through the sys-
tem.
As the system is not designed to play video 
through Apple CarPlay/Android Auto, this is not 
a malfunction.

●If a USB hub is plugged-in, two 
devices can be connected at a 
time.
●Even if a USB hub is used to con-
nect more than two USB devices, 
only the first two connected 
devices will be recognized.
●If a USB hub that has more than 
two ports is connected to the USB 
port, devices connected to the 
USB hub may not  charge or be 
operable, as the supply of current 
may be insufficient.
